This is an automated email from the ASF dual-hosted git repository.

rakeshr pushed a change to branch HDDS-2939
in repository https://gitbox.apache.org/repos/asf/hadoop-ozone.git.


 discard 61100d0  HDDS-4266: CreateFile : store parent dir entries into 
DirTable and file entry into separate FileTable (#1473)
    omit e32552b  HDDS-2949: mkdir : store directory entries in a separate 
table (#1404)
     add 55c9df8  HDDS-4290. Enable insight point for SCM heartbeat protocol 
(#1453)
     add 60d2bcc  HDDS-4274. Change the log level of the SCM Delete block to 
improve performance. (#1446)
     add f8a62d6  HDDS-3810. Add the logic to distribute open containers among 
the pipelines of a datanode. (#1274)
     add 5719615  HDDS-4304. Close Container event can fail if pipeline is 
removed first. (#1471)
     add 8cd86a6  HDDS-4299. Display Ratis version with ozone version (#1464)
     add cfff097  HDDS-4271. Avoid logging chunk content in Ozone Insight 
(#1466)
     add 4ad0318  HDDS-4264. Uniform naming conventions of Ozone Shell Options. 
(#1447)
     add d6d27e4  HDDS-4242. Copy PrefixInfo proto to new project 
hadoop-ozone/interface-storage (#1444)
     add 19cb481  HDDS-4156. add hierarchical layout to Chinese doc (#1368)
     add b6efb95  HDDS-4280. Document notable configurations for Recon. (#1448)
     add 0d7d1e2  HDDS-4298. Use an interface in Ozone client instead of 
XceiverClientManager (#1460)
     add f9b1ca4  HDDS-4310: Ozone getconf broke the compatibility (#1475)
     add efaa4fc  HDDS-4309. Fix inconsistency in recon config keys starting 
with recon and not ozone (#1478)
     add e0a3baf  HDDS-4325. Incompatible return codes from Ozone getconf 
-confKey (#1485). Contributed by Doroszlai, Attila.
     add 55d1e91  HDDS-4316. Upgrade to angular 1.8.0 due to CVE-2020-7676 
(#1481)
     add d08a4c1  HDDS-3728. Bucket space: check quotaUsageInBytes when write 
key and allocate block. (#1458)
     add 7704cb5  HDDS-3814. Drop a column family through debug cli tool (#1083)
     add a1d53b0  HDDS-4311. Type-safe config design doc points to OM HA (#1477)
     add 5c5d8cb  HDDS-4312. findbugs check succeeds despite compile error 
(#1476)
     add 35cc6b0  HDDS-4285. Read is slow due to frequent calls to 
UGI.getCurrentUser() and getTokens() (#1454)
     add c956ce6  HDDS-4262. Use ClientID and CallID from Rpc Client to detect 
retry requests (#1436)
     add dc889b4  Remove extra serialization from getBlockID (#1470)
     add 7ae037e  HDDS-4336. ContainerInfo does not persist BCSID (sequenceId) 
leading to failed replica reports (#1488)
     add 7db0ea8  HDDS-4122. Implement OM Delete Expired Open Key Request and 
Response (#1435)
     new 6f2fa22  HDDS-2949: mkdir : store directory entries in a separate 
table (#1404)
     new 51bb909  HDDS-4266: CreateFile : store parent dir entries into 
DirTable and file entry into separate FileTable (#1473)

This update added new revisions after undoing existing revisions.
That is to say, some revisions that were in the old version of the
branch are not in the new version.  This situation occurs
when a user --force pushes a change and generates a repository
containing something like this:

 * -- * -- B -- O -- O -- O   (61100d0)
            \
             N -- N -- N   refs/heads/HDDS-2939 (51bb909)

You should already have received notification emails for all of the O
revisions, and so the following emails describe only the N revisions
from the common base, B.

Any revisions marked "omit" are not gone; other references still
refer to them.  Any revisions marked "discard" are gone forever.

The 2 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ails.  The revisions
listed as "add" were already present in the repository and have only
been added to this reference.


Summary of changes:
 LICENSE.txt                                        |   4 +-
 .../hadoop/hdds/scm/XceiverClientFactory.java}     |  24 +-
 .../hadoop/hdds/scm/XceiverClientManager.java      |  40 +-
 .../hadoop/hdds/scm/storage/BlockInputStream.java  |  62 ++-
 .../hadoop/hdds/scm/storage/BlockOutputStream.java |  37 +-
 .../apache/hadoop/hdds/scm/storage/BufferPool.java |   2 +-
 .../hadoop/hdds/scm/storage/ChunkInputStream.java  |  10 +-
 .../hdds/scm/storage/DummyChunkInputStream.java    |   2 +-
 .../storage/TestBlockOutputStreamCorrectness.java  |   2 +-
 .../hadoop/hdds/scm/ByteStringConversion.java      |  18 +-
 .../org/apache/hadoop/hdds/scm/ScmConfigKeys.java  |   4 +
 .../hadoop/hdds/scm/container/ContainerInfo.java   |   2 +
 .../hdds/scm/storage/ContainerProtocolCalls.java   | 139 +++----
 .../{VersionInfo.java => RatisVersionInfo.java}    |  66 +---
 .../org/apache/hadoop/hdds/utils/VersionInfo.java  |   9 +-
 .../common/src/main/resources/ozone-default.xml    |  19 +-
 .../container/common/helpers/ContainerUtils.java   |  66 +++-
 .../container/common/impl/HddsDispatcher.java      |   4 +-
 .../ozone/container/keyvalue/KeyValueHandler.java  |  14 +-
 .../container/keyvalue/impl/BlockManagerImpl.java  |  15 +-
 .../main/resources/webapps/hddsDatanode/index.html |   4 +-
 hadoop-hdds/docs/content/concept/Datanodes.zh.md   |   3 +
 hadoop-hdds/docs/content/concept/Overview.zh.md    |   5 +
 .../docs/content/concept/OzoneManager.zh.md        |   3 +
 .../content/concept/StorageContainerManager.zh.md  |   3 +
 hadoop-hdds/docs/content/concept/_index.zh.md      |   2 +-
 hadoop-hdds/docs/content/design/typesafeconfig.md  |  10 +-
 hadoop-hdds/docs/content/feature/Recon.md          |  18 +-
 hadoop-hdds/docs/content/interface/CSI.zh.md       |   3 +
 hadoop-hdds/docs/content/interface/JavaApi.zh.md   |   3 +
 hadoop-hdds/docs/content/interface/O3fs.zh.md      |   3 +
 hadoop-hdds/docs/content/interface/S3.zh.md        |   3 +
 .../docs/content/security/SecureOzone.zh.md        |   3 +
 hadoop-hdds/docs/content/security/SecuringS3.zh.md |   3 +
 .../docs/content/security/SecuringTDE.zh.md        |   3 +
 .../docs/content/security/SecurityAcls.zh.md       |   3 +
 .../docs/content/security/SecurityWithRanger.zh.md |   3 +
 hadoop-hdds/docs/content/tools/TestTools.md        |   2 +-
 hadoop-hdds/docs/content/tools/TestTools.zh.md     |   2 +-
 .../server/OzoneProtocolMessageDispatcher.java     |  32 +-
 .../resources/webapps/static/angular-1.7.9.min.js  | 350 -----------------
 .../resources/webapps/static/angular-1.8.0.min.js  | 350 +++++++++++++++++
 ...ute-1.7.9.min.js => angular-route-1.8.0.min.js} |   6 +-
 hadoop-hdds/pom.xml                                |   4 +-
 .../hdds/scm/container/SCMContainerManager.java    |  23 +-
 .../apache/hadoop/hdds/scm/node/DatanodeInfo.java  |  33 ++
 .../apache/hadoop/hdds/scm/node/NodeManager.java   |   6 +-
 .../hadoop/hdds/scm/node/SCMNodeManager.java       |  53 ++-
 .../hadoop/hdds/scm/pipeline/PipelineManager.java  |   4 +-
 .../hdds/scm/pipeline/PipelinePlacementPolicy.java |   7 +-
 .../hdds/scm/pipeline/RatisPipelineProvider.java   |   6 +-
 .../hdds/scm/pipeline/SCMPipelineManager.java      |  16 +-
 .../hdds/scm/server/SCMBlockProtocolServer.java    |   6 +-
 .../src/main/resources/webapps/scm/index.html      |   4 +-
 .../hadoop/hdds/scm/block/TestBlockManager.java    |  69 ++++
 .../hadoop/hdds/scm/container/MockNodeManager.java |  28 +-
 .../hadoop/hdds/scm/node/TestSCMNodeManager.java   |   4 +-
 .../scm/pipeline/TestPipelinePlacementPolicy.java  |   4 +-
 .../hdds/scm/pipeline/TestSCMPipelineManager.java  |  74 ++++
 .../testutils/ReplicationNodeManagerMock.java      |  12 +-
 .../scm/cli/pipeline/CreatePipelineSubcommand.java |  10 +-
 .../ozone/client/io/BlockOutputStreamEntry.java    |  30 +-
 .../client/io/BlockOutputStreamEntryPool.java      |  34 +-
 .../hadoop/ozone/client/io/KeyInputStream.java     |  36 +-
 .../hadoop/ozone/client/io/KeyOutputStream.java    |  56 +--
 .../apache/hadoop/ozone/client/rpc/RpcClient.java  |   6 +
 .../main/java/org/apache/hadoop/ozone/OmUtils.java |   1 +
 .../hadoop/ozone/om/helpers/OmKeyLocationInfo.java |   6 +-
 .../apache/hadoop/ozone/util/OzoneVersionInfo.java |  15 +-
 hadoop-ozone/dev-support/checks/findbugs.sh        |   7 +-
 .../dist/src/main/compose/ozone/docker-config      |   2 +-
 .../main/compose/ozonesecure-om-ha/docker-config   |   4 +-
 .../src/main/compose/ozonesecure/docker-config     |   4 +-
 .../dist/src/main/compose/upgrade/docker-config    |   2 +-
 .../main/k8s/definitions/ozone/freon/freon.yaml    |   2 +-
 .../getting-started/freon/freon-deployment.yaml    |   2 +-
 .../examples/minikube/freon/freon-deployment.yaml  |   2 +-
 .../examples/ozone-dev/freon/freon-deployment.yaml |   2 +-
 .../k8s/examples/ozone/freon/freon-deployment.yaml |   2 +-
 hadoop-ozone/dist/src/main/license/bin/LICENSE.txt |   4 +-
 .../main/smoketest/auditparser/auditparser.robot   |   2 +-
 .../dist/src/main/smoketest/basic/basic.robot      |   2 +-
 .../dist/src/main/smoketest/basic/getconf.robot    |  37 +-
 .../src/main/smoketest/basic/ozone-shell-lib.robot |   2 +-
 .../dist/src/main/smoketest/freon/freon.robot      |   2 +-
 .../dist/src/main/smoketest/recon/recon-api.robot  |   2 +-
 .../dist/src/main/smoketest/spnego/web.robot       |   2 +-
 .../hadoop/ozone/TestMiniChaosOzoneCluster.java    |  40 +-
 .../src/test/blockade/ozone/client.py              |  10 +-
 .../ozone/insight/BaseInsightSubCommand.java       |   3 +
 .../java/org/apache/hadoop/ozone/TestDataUtil.java |  13 +-
 .../hadoop/ozone/TestOzoneConfigurationFields.java |  11 +-
 .../client/rpc/TestOzoneRpcClientAbstract.java     |  67 +++-
 .../hadoop/ozone/client/rpc/TestReadRetries.java   |  40 +-
 .../hadoop/ozone/fsck/TestContainerMapper.java     |   3 +
 .../ozone/om/TestOzoneManagerHAMetadataOnly.java   |  76 ++++
 .../ozone/recon/TestReconWithOzoneManager.java     |  32 +-
 .../hadoop/ozone/scm/TestCloseContainer.java       | 148 ++++++++
 .../hadoop/ozone/scm/TestContainerSmallFile.java   |  20 +-
 .../scm/TestGetCommittedBlockLengthAndPutKey.java  |   4 +-
 .../hadoop/ozone/scm/TestXceiverClientGrpc.java    |   6 +-
 .../src/main/proto/OmClientProtocol.proto          |  17 +
 .../dev-support/findbugsExcludeFile.xml            |   2 +-
 hadoop-ozone/interface-storage/pom.xml             |  39 +-
 .../hadoop/ozone/om/codec/OmPrefixInfoCodec.java   |   5 +-
 .../hadoop/ozone/om/helpers/OmPrefixInfo.java      |  13 +-
 .../hadoop/ozone/om/helpers/OzoneAclStorage.java   |  63 ++++
 .../ozone/om/helpers/OzoneAclStorageUtil.java      |  62 +++
 .../hadoop/ozone/om/helpers}/package-info.java     |   4 +-
 .../src/main/proto/OmStorageProtocol.proto         |  60 +++
 .../hadoop/ozone/om/helpers/TestOmPrefixInfo.java  |   0
 .../hadoop/ozone/om/helpers}/package-info.java     |   4 +-
 .../java/org/apache/hadoop/ozone/om/OMMetrics.java |  37 ++
 .../ozone/om/ratis/OzoneManagerRatisServer.java    |  11 +-
 .../ozone/om/request/file/OMFileCreateRequest.java |   3 +-
 .../om/request/key/OMAllocateBlockRequest.java     |   3 +-
 .../ozone/om/request/key/OMKeyCreateRequest.java   |   3 +-
 .../ozone/om/request/key/OMKeyDeleteRequest.java   |  11 +-
 .../hadoop/ozone/om/request/key/OMKeyRequest.java  |  56 ++-
 .../ozone/om/request/key/OMKeysDeleteRequest.java  |  12 +-
 .../om/request/volume/OMVolumeCreateRequest.java   |   6 +
 ...ponse.java => AbstractOMKeyDeleteResponse.java} |  68 ++--
 .../ozone/om/response/key/OMKeyDeleteResponse.java |  73 +---
 .../om/response/key/OMKeysDeleteResponse.java      |  38 +-
 .../om/response/key/OMOpenKeysDeleteRequest.java   | 192 ++++++++++
 ...Response.java => OMOpenKeysDeleteResponse.java} |  57 ++-
 .../main/resources/webapps/ozoneManager/index.html |   4 +-
 .../ozone/om/request/TestOMRequestUtils.java       |  48 ++-
 .../request/key/TestOMOpenKeysDeleteRequest.java   | 419 +++++++++++++++++++++
 .../om/response/key/TestOMKeysDeleteResponse.java  |  12 +-
 .../response/key/TestOMOpenKeysDeleteResponse.java | 185 +++++++++
 hadoop-ozone/pom.xml                               |   4 +-
 .../hadoop/ozone/recon/ReconServerConfigKeys.java  |  48 ++-
 .../spi/impl/OzoneManagerServiceProviderImpl.java  |  52 ++-
 .../spi/impl/PrometheusServiceProviderImpl.java    |  17 +-
 .../ozone/conf/OzoneManagersCommandHandler.java    |   1 +
 .../ozone/conf/PrintConfKeyCommandHandler.java     |   5 +-
 .../StorageContainerManagersCommandHandler.java    |   1 +
 .../apache/hadoop/ozone/debug/ChunkKeyHandler.java |  11 +-
 .../org/apache/hadoop/ozone/debug/DBScanner.java   |  18 +-
 .../org/apache/hadoop/ozone/debug/DropTable.java   |  81 ++++
 .../GetAclHandler.java => debug/RocksDBUtils.java} |  33 +-
 .../hadoop/ozone/freon/HadoopDirTreeGenerator.java |  15 +-
 .../ozone/freon/HadoopNestedDirGenerator.java      |   5 +-
 .../hadoop/ozone/freon/RandomKeyGenerator.java     |  40 +-
 .../hadoop/ozone/conf/TestGetConfOptions.java      |  90 +++++
 146 files changed, 3199 insertions(+), 1187 deletions(-)
 copy 
hadoop-hdds/{container-service/src/main/java/org/apache/hadoop/ozone/container/common/interfaces/ContainerLocationManagerMXBean.java
 => client/src/main/java/org/apache/hadoop/hdds/scm/XceiverClientFactory.java} 
(63%)
 copy 
hadoop-hdds/common/src/main/java/org/apache/hadoop/hdds/utils/{VersionInfo.java 
=> RatisVersionInfo.java} (50%)
 delete mode 100644 
hadoop-hdds/framework/src/main/resources/webapps/static/angular-1.7.9.min.js
 create mode 100644 
hadoop-hdds/framework/src/main/resources/webapps/static/angular-1.8.0.min.js
 rename 
hadoop-hdds/framework/src/main/resources/webapps/static/{angular-route-1.7.9.min.js
 => angular-route-1.8.0.min.js} (97%)
 create mode 100644 
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/ozone/scm/TestCloseContainer.java
 copy {hadoop-hdds/interface-server => 
hadoop-ozone/interface-storage}/dev-support/findbugsExcludeFile.xml (93%)
 rename hadoop-ozone/{common => 
interface-storage}/src/main/java/org/apache/hadoop/ozone/om/helpers/OmPrefixInfo.java
 (92%)
 create mode 100644 
hadoop-ozone/interface-storage/src/main/java/org/apache/hadoop/ozone/om/helpers/OzoneAclStorage.java
 create mode 100644 
hadoop-ozone/interface-storage/src/main/java/org/apache/hadoop/ozone/om/helpers/OzoneAclStorageUtil.java
 copy 
hadoop-ozone/interface-storage/src/{test/java/org/apache/hadoop/ozone/om/codec 
=> main/java/org/apache/hadoop/ozone/om/helpers}/package-info.java (91%)
 create mode 100644 
hadoop-ozone/interface-storage/src/main/proto/OmStorageProtocol.proto
 rename hadoop-ozone/{common => 
interface-storage}/src/test/java/org/apache/hadoop/ozone/om/helpers/TestOmPrefixInfo.java
 (100%)
 copy hadoop-ozone/interface-storage/src/{main/java/org/apache/hadoop/ozone/om 
=> test/java/org/apache/hadoop/ozone/om/helpers}/package-info.java (92%)
 copy 
hadoop-ozone/ozone-manager/src/main/java/org/apache/hadoop/ozone/om/response/key/{OMKeyDeleteResponse.java
 => AbstractOMKeyDeleteResponse.java} (64%)
 create mode 100644 
hadoop-ozone/ozone-manager/src/main/java/org/apache/hadoop/ozone/om/response/key/OMOpenKeysDeleteRequest.java
 copy 
hadoop-ozone/ozone-manager/src/main/java/org/apache/hadoop/ozone/om/response/key/{OMKeyRenameResponse.java
 => OMOpenKeysDeleteResponse.java} (55%)
 create mode 100644 
hadoop-ozone/ozone-manager/src/test/java/org/apache/hadoop/ozone/om/request/key/TestOMOpenKeysDeleteRequest.java
 create mode 100644 
hadoop-ozone/ozone-manager/src/test/java/org/apache/hadoop/ozone/om/response/key/TestOMOpenKeysDeleteResponse.java
 create mode 100644 
hadoop-ozone/tools/src/main/java/org/apache/hadoop/ozone/debug/DropTable.java
 copy 
hadoop-ozone/tools/src/main/java/org/apache/hadoop/ozone/{shell/acl/GetAclHandler.java
 => debug/RocksDBUtils.java} (54%)
 create mode 100644 
hadoop-ozone/tools/src/test/java/org/apache/hadoop/ozone/conf/TestGetConfOptions.java


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to